About Dolby Laboratories, Inc.

Dolby Laboratories Inc develops audio and surround sound for cinema, broadcast, home audio systems, in-car entertainment systems, DVD players, games, televisions, and personal computers. The company generates three fourths of its revenue from licensing its technology to consumer electronics manufacturers around the world. The rest of revenue comes from equipment sales to professional producers and audio engineering services.

About Veritone Inc

Veritone is a leading provider of enterprise AI software and solutions, centered on its proprietary AI operating system, aiWARE™. The platform orchestrates a vast ecosystem of machine learning models to transform unstructured data—such as audio, video, and text—into actionable intelligence. Serving the media, entertainment, and public sectors, Veritone is a critical infrastructure partner for organizations looking to monetize data archives and operationalize AI at scale.
